ASIN Blocked Again After 5 Months Despite Full Health & Safety Compliance

Hello fellow sellers,

I'm facing a serious issue with one of my ASINs that I believe Amazon should have resolved long ago — hoping someone here has been through this or can suggest next steps.

This product was initially blocked for health and safety compliance reasons. I fully understand the importance of customer safety, so I submitted all required documentation, including:

A valid FDA certificate proving the product meets all relevant health standards

A Letter of Compliance from the manufacturer on official letterhead

Instruction manuals in both English and French to meet bilingual labeling requirements

Clear product images and SKU details matching the Amazon listing

After being inactive for over 5 months, the listing was finally reactivated — but then blocked again just a few weeks later without any further request or explanation.

Now it has been almost half a year since this ordeal began. I’ve reached out to Amazon Regulatory several times, but keep getting copy-paste responses saying the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C) is still reviewing it and there’s no timeline.

Meanwhile, 104 units are stuck in FBA, and my business is suffering because I can’t sell or even plan properly. I’ve done everything by the book. If there’s a real safety issue, they haven’t said what it is. And if there isn’t, why is my listing still blocked?

This is exhausting. Has anyone here been through something similar? Is there any escalation path that worked for you?

Thanks in advance for any help or advice.

FDA is a US agency, and you are posting in the Canadian Seller Marketplace. The FDA has no power in Canada as they are a US agency.

Your product needs to meet Canadian federal government safety standards.
